권한 및 데이터 관련 UI 가이드라인

원활하고 안심할 수 있는 사용자 환경을 촉진하려면 UX에 앱이 헬스 커넥트에서 사용하는 데이터에 액세스하는 방식을 명확하게 설명하는 권한 화면을 포함하고 데이터가 사용되는 방식을 사용자가 이해하는 데 도움이 되는 방식으로 데이터 소스를 표시해야 합니다.

권한 요청 방법

앱에서 권한을 요청할 때마다 UX에서는 액세스하려는 데이터 유형을 명확하게 설명해야 합니다.

기본 권한

신규 헬스 커넥트 사용자

다음은 앱이 새로운 헬스 커넥트 사용자에게 권한을 요청할 수 있는 세 가지 방법을 보여주는 예시입니다.

앱 홈 화면의 프로모션 카드

신규 사용자 - 홈 화면

설정 메뉴의 옵션

다른 모든 진입점은 선택사항이지만 설정 메뉴에서 권한을 요청하는 옵션은 앱에서 항상 제공해야 합니다.

신규 사용자 - 설정

앱의 온보딩 흐름에 통합

신규 사용자 - 최초 설정

취소된 권한

앱의 '설정' 화면에서는 사용자에게 헬스 커넥트 데이터 유형에 관한 권한을 취소하는 간단한 방법을 제공해야 합니다.

권한 취소

권한 부족

앱의 Health Connect API 액세스 권한이 충분하지 않으면 모든 진입점에서 사용자에게 다음 화면이 표시됩니다.

앱의 헬스 커넥트 액세스 권한이 충분하지 않음

권한이 두 번 취소됨

사용자가 권한 요청 화면에서 '취소'를 연속으로 두 번 선택하는 경우 앱은 사용자에게 다음과 유사한 화면을 표시해야 합니다.

권한 요청 차단됨

기여 분석

신뢰를 쌓고 안심할 수 있도록 하려면 앱에서 데이터를 얻는 방법을 사용자에게 보여주는 것이 중요합니다. 여기에는 두 가지 방법이 있습니다.

  1. 기본 기여 분석
  2. 교육을 통한 기여 분석

기본 기여 분석

최소한 사용자 인터페이스(UI)에는 앱 소스 아이콘이름이 표시되어야 합니다(또는 아이콘을 표시할 수 없는 경우에는 앱 이름만).

기본 기여 분석은 다음 화면에 적합합니다.

  • 활동 로그
  • 활동 세부정보

홈 화면의 아이콘

기본 기여 분석 - 예시 1

활동 로그의 아이콘 및 앱 이름

기본 기여 분석 - 예시 2

교육을 통한 기여 분석

헬스 커넥트의 '앱 권한' 화면으로 직접 연결되는 링크를 통해 사용자가 데이터의 출처에 관한 정보를 쉽게 얻을 수 있도록 해야 합니다.

이 유형의 기여 분석은 다음 화면에 적합합니다.

  • 활동 세부정보
  • 보고서 및 통계

활동 세부정보 화면의 버튼

교육을 통한 기여 분석 - 예시 1

보고서 화면의 앱 바 아이콘 또는 버튼

교육을 통한 기여 분석 - 예시 2

삽입된 정보

교육을 통한 기여 분석 - 예시 3

위의 두 화면은 모두 헬스 커넥트를 통해 데이터에 액세스하는 앱을 사용자가 제어할 수 있는 '데이터 정보' 화면에 연결되어야 합니다.

헬스 커넥트 권한 관리

데이터 동기화

데이터 동기화가 발생하면, 특히 작업이 완료되는 데 시간이 걸릴 수 있는 경우 사용자에게 알려야 합니다.

동기화 알림